Initiatives in memory of Gigi Riva are multiplying throughout the regional territory. To pay homage to the memory of the rossoblù champion, absolute protagonist of the 1970 scudetto epic, Dolianova dedicated a graffiti to him which since yesterday has appeared on the shutter of Gino Pacitto's newsstand in the central square of the town.

It was created by Ivo Pittiu, 25 years old , a young hairdresser with a passion for drawing. The graffiti created with spray cans portrays the spectacular overhead kick goal scored by Riva at the “Romeo Menti” stadium in Vicenza on 18 January 1970, a decisive victory for winning the legendary championship. «I was the one who proposed it to the newsagent, he welcomed the idea with enthusiasm – says Pittiu – I have had a passion for drawing since I was a child, I am happy that someone gave me this opportunity to express myself in a public place. I would like to continue doing so by giving color to some unused space in our country."

A tribute to Riva welcomed with great favor by the community very attached to the rossoblù myth: «Many have complimented – says the owner of the newsstand Gino Pacitto – soon other drawings will be made on the side shutters, one will still be dedicated to Riva and the others to the traditional masks of the Sardinian carnival".
